Legacy

Nomads Rehearsal Studios was founded by Alan Luckett in 2019. Alan had many different careers within the entertainment industry and was most well known for being the Sound Engineer and Tour Manager for bands such as Killing Miranda and the Jam!

He ran a production company from what would then become the rehearsal rooms, although at the time it was one large warehouse. There has been a private studio on site for many years before Nomads came to be. As his life went on and having a family of his own, he dreamed of a life off road – and so Nomads came into existence.

Work started on transforming the warehouse into rehearsal rooms in 2019 with the first room being finished in early 2020. The second room was finished in 2022 and work also took place to build a dojo upstairs which he was also a student of.

In 2022, Alan was sadly diagnosed with cancer and passed away in December of 2023 surrounded by family.

We strive to keep his legacy alive through Nomads.
